    Abstract: Background: The B-MaP-C study aimed to determine alterations to breast cancer (BC) management during the peak transmission period of the UK COVID-19 pandemic and the potential impact of these treatment decisions. Methods: This was a national cohort study of patients with early BC undergoing multidisciplinary team (MDT)-guided treatment recommendations during the pandemic, designated ‘standard’ or ‘COVID-altered’, in the preoperative, operative and post-operative setting. Findings: Of 3776 patients (from 64 UK units) in the study, 2246 (59%) had ‘COVID-altered’ management. ‘Bridging’ endocrine therapy was used (n = 951) where theatre capacity was reduced. There was increasing access to COVID-19 low-risk theatres during the study period (59%). In line with national guidance, immediate breast reconstruction was avoided (n = 299). Where adjuvant chemotherapy was omitted (n = 81), the median benefit was only 3% (IQR 2–9%) using ‘NHS Predict’. There was the rapid adoption of new evidence-based hypofractionated radiotherapy (n = 781, from 46 units). Only 14 patients (1%) tested positive for SARS-CoV-2 during their treatment journey. Conclusions: The majority of ‘COVID-altered’ management decisions were largely in line with pre-COVID evidence-based guidelines, implying that breast cancer survival outcomes are unlikely to be negatively impacted by the pandemic. However, in this study, the potential impact of delays to BC presentation or diagnosis remains unknown

    Sunday, September 11, 2016 -- 2:00-3:30pm The Archive Thief by Lisa Moses Leff Facilitated by Dr. Elizabeth Drummond, History Dept. In the aftermath of the Holocaust, the Jewish historian Zosa Szajkowski stole tens of thousands of archival documents related to French Jewish history from public archives and collections in France and moved them, illicitly, to New York. Why did this respectable historian become a thief? And why did librarians in the United States and Israel accept these materials from him, turning a blind eye to the signs of ownership they bore? In The Archive Thief, Lisa Moses Leff reconstructs Szajkowski\u27s gripping story in all its ambiguity. Born into poverty in Russian Poland in 1911, Szajkowski was a self-made man who managed to make a life for himself as an intellectual, first as a journalist in 1930s Paris, and then, after a harrowing escape to New York in 1941, as a scholar. Although he never taught at a university or even earned a PhD, Szajkowski became one of the world\u27s foremost experts on the history of the Jews in modern France, publishing in Yiddish, English, and Hebrew. His work opened up new ways of thinking about Jewish emancipation, economic and social modernization, and the rise of modern anti-Semitism. But beneath Szajkowski\u27s scholarly accomplishments lay his shameful secret: his pathbreaking articles were based upon documents that he moved illicitly to New York. Eventually, he sold these documents, piecemeal, to American and Israeli research libraries where they still remain. Leff takes us into the backstage of the archives, revealing the powerful ideological, economic, and psychological forces that made Holocaust-era Jewish scholars care more deeply than ever before about preserving the remnants of their past. As Leff shows, it is only when we understand the issues at the heart of his story, in all their ambiguity and complexity, that we can begin to address the larger questions of the rightful ownership of Jewish archives, as well as other contested archives, that are still at issue today.https://digitalcommons.lmu.edu/jewishbookgroup/1000/thumbnail.jp

También se toman en cuenta los errores de medición referidos a los tiempos.This paper aims to examine and select the parts of a distributed control system for an installation of solar concentrators. The system consists of a microcontroller network responsible for carrying out control tasks supervised by a central computer. In this paper compares the performance of microcontrollers, microprocessors and various connectivity options. The PIC18F4550 microcontroller selects the work to carry out the tasks of monitoring, analyzing the I2C connectivity options and Zigbee. It also takes into account measurement errors relating to the times.Asociación Argentina de Energías Renovables y Medio Ambiente (ASADES

    Given the profound impact of language impairment after stroke (aphasia), neuroplasticity research is garnering considerable attention as means for eventually improving aphasia treatments and how they are delivered. Functional and structural neuroimaging studies indicate that aphasia treatments can recruit both residual and new neural mechanisms to improve language function and that neuroimaging modalities may hold promise in predicting treatment outcome. In relatively small clinical trials, both non-invasive brain stimulation and behavioural manipulations targeting activation or suppression of specific cortices can improve aphasia treatment outcomes. Recent language interventions that employ principles consistent with inducing neuroplasticity also are showing improved performance for both trained and novel items and contexts. While knowledge is rapidly accumulating, larger trials emphasising how to select optimal paradigms for individualised aphasia treatment are needed. Finally, a model of how to incorporate the growing knowledge into clinical practice could help to focus future research
